A tropical depression barreled down Thua Thien-Hue on September 26, causing rains also to nearby provinces like Quang Tri, Quang Binh, Ha Tinh, Nghe An and Thanh Hoa. By September 28, the rains had expanded to the plains and certain mountainous areas of northern Vietnam. By September 30, nine people in Thanh Hoa, Son La, Quang Tri, Hoa Binh, Phu Tho and Nghe An had been confirmed dead amid floods and landslides, according to the National Steering Center for Natural Disaster Prevention. One in Son La and another in Binh Phuoc were swept away by floods and rendered missing. 10 people in Thua Thien-Hue and Nghe An were injured. Rains and floods have also damaged over 44,000 ha of rice and crops, mostly in Ha Nam, Nam Dinh, Thai Binh, Nghe An and Thanh Hoa provinces. Over 240 spots were eroded, with 31,000 m3 of rubble collapsing. Traffic has since resumed normally in these areas. Nail traps allegedly placed on road by robbers in Vietnam’s Long An
Police in Long An Province, southern Vietnam said on Saturday that they were probing a case in which boards with upward-facing nails were believed to be put on a road in Thu Thua District by a group of vandals in an attempt to commit robberies. According to a police report, T., a 42-year-old local resident in Long An, and her relative noticed two boards full of nails left on the road, numbered 818, running through Thu Thua’s Tan Thanh Commune while they were traveling in a car from southern Tay Ninh Province at around 7:30 pm on Friday. They stopped the car and T. stepped out to go toward the two boards. As soon as she picked them up, a local inhabitant holding a flashlight ran to her and warned her against robbers in the area. The local resident told her that a group of people were hiding by the roadside. T. immediately put the boards aside, returned to the car, and drove away.
